CINCINNATI, Ohio — The Bengals fired coach Marvin Lewis on Monday, ending a 16-year stay in Cincinnati that included seven playoff appearances without so much as one win. The move ends the second-longest head coaching tenure in the league. New England’s Bill Belichick is wrapping up his 19th season with another postseason berth. He’s won five Super […]

CLEVELAND, OH (WOIO) – Former Cleveland Cavaliers guard and current Boston Celtics guard Kyrie Irving will miss the rest of the NBA season and the 2018 NBA Playoffs. ESPN reporter Adrian Wojnarowski had the news first and posted the report on Twitter. The Celtics will most likely be the No. 2 seed in the Eastern […]

CLEVELAND – On Sunday, Joe Thomas missed the first snap of his 11-year career when he was forced to leave the Cleveland Browns’ 12-9 overtime loss to the Tennessee Titans with an arm injury. As it turns out, Thomas’ absence will continue through the remainder of the 2017 season. According to the team, Thomas will miss […]

CLEVELAND, Ohio — The Cavaliers’ Andrew Bogut is out for the remainder of the season and the play-offs after fracturing his left leg less than one minute into his Cleveland debut Monday night. During the game against the Miami Heat, Bogut appeared to take a knee into his lower leg in the first minute of the […]

CLEVELAND, Ohio — Kevin Love has not been cleared to play in Game 3 of the NBA Finals. The Cleveland Cavaliers said in a statement that Love will remain in the NBA’s concussion protocol. His status for Game 4 “will be updated at the appropriate time.” Love was injured in the first half of Sunday’s Game 2 when […]

CLEVELAND – Cleveland Cavaliers forward Kevin Love has officially opted out of the final year of his contract, ESPN reports . ESPN’s March Stein was first to report the news and says Love turned down $16.7 million he was scheduled to make next year and will become a free agent July 1. Love had his […]
